It’s fair to say Xavi could have asked for an easier start to life as
Barcelona manager. First up in the league at the weekend was the derby – although, yes, admittedly Espanyol enter into these affairs with about as much chance of claiming local bragging rights as, say, Red Star
Paris, 1860 Munich or Everton – and now comes a crunch Big Cup tie that could make or break their season.
